Alexandra Kosteniukchess gm with roots in the Russian Empire

Alexandra Kosteniuk, born 1984 in Perm, became Women's World Chess Champion in 2008. Known as 'Chess Queen,' she holds the GM title and has represented both Russia and Switzerland internationally.

Trained from age five by her father Konstantin in Soviet chess tradition, Kosteniuk embodies the rigorous pedagogical culture of Russian chess schools. Perm's competitive provincial chess scene forged her tactical discipline.
